4-Heptyloxybenzoyl chloride

Base Information Edit
  • Chemical Name:4-Heptyloxybenzoyl chloride
  • CAS No.:40782-54-5
  • Molecular Formula:C14H19ClO2
  • Molecular Weight:254.757
  • Hs Code.:2918990090
  • European Community (EC) Number:255-077-5
  • DSSTox Substance ID:DTXSID70961199
  • Nikkaji Number:J28.746F
  • Wikidata:Q82942557
  • Mol file:40782-54-5.mol
4-Heptyloxybenzoyl chloride

Synonyms:4-Heptyloxybenzoyl chloride;40782-54-5;4-heptoxybenzoyl chloride;4-(Heptyloxy)benzoyl chloride;4-n-Heptyloxybenzoyl chloride;EINECS 255-077-5;4-n-Heptyloxybenzoylchloride;p-heptyloxybenzoyl chloride;SCHEMBL1019300;DTXSID70961199;Benzoyl chloride, 4-(heptyloxy)-;AKOS015889284;FT-0616778

Chemical Property of 4-Heptyloxybenzoyl chloride Edit
Chemical Property:
  • Appearance/Colour:clear light yellow liquid 
  • Vapor Pressure:5.2E-05mmHg at 25°C 
  • Melting Point:226-227 ºC 
  • Refractive Index:n20/D 1.533(lit.)  
  • Boiling Point:348 °C at 760 mmHg 
  • Flash Point:131 °C 
  • PSA:26.30000 
  • Density:1.066 g/cm3 
  • LogP:4.41480 
  • XLogP3:5.4
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:2
  • Rotatable Bond Count:8
  • Exact Mass:254.1073575
  • Heavy Atom Count:17
  • Complexity:210
